When is Yahoo Search Marketing Releasing a Desktop Editor?

Google has an AdWords Editor, Microsoft is testing adCenter Editor (beta), but there is no word from Yahoo on a desktop editor for their Search Marketing platform.

An old WebmasterWorld thread was recently refreshed with the question, when is it coming?

One member recently received a survey from Yahoo's Lori Love Vice President of Customer Solutions. The survey mentioned the editor, but had no hint as to when of if it will ever come. One advertiser was told by his platinum specialist that Yahoo advertisers may see something in the first quarter of 2009. He did add that the editor will be lacking many features that you currently find in AdWords Editor.

Yahoo has been under a lot of stress recently, primarily over their search ads division. I wonder if the editor is a priority right now for them.
